coinspot has very low fees on market transactions (0.1%) which i think is one of the cheapest all-in that i can find for lower volumes (call out if anyone thinks otherwise).

Just don't use insta buy as that is 1% and i think it's how they keep the low fee as most people confuse the two. Make sure you only ever use market transactions (the confusing/harder to use way of buying/selling with the graph and market orders)

Bitaroo is cheaper if you have volume (>$1m)

Independent reserve actually more expense - only at $5m is it 0.1%.

Bitcoin is reflexive (as defined by George Soros in Alchemy of Finance).

It has heaps of positive feedback loops. A price of $100k would increase all the things that lead to a higher price - adoption (FOMO would drive more people in), acceptance as a means of payment/legitimate commodity investment, more innovation/layer 2 development, more miners (increasing security), increased confidence in its ability to store value etc.

So weirdly a higher price leads to a higher price. Some lags but directionally it holds.

It isn't independently valued either so this effect is super strong. Its fundamental value depends on various things like mining costs, the utility of the network, confidence in it as a store of value relative to alternatives and adoption. Again - a higher price only makes these things stronger due to the reflexivity above.

I followed Bitcoin closely since the very beginning but didn't get involved super early because I misunderstood this. I was too focused on intrinsic value as you see with most financial assets - but most aren't directly reflexive like Bitcoin. If the price of Microsoft stock pumps - there's a point where it just doesn't make sense relative to the cash flows or liquidation value. Same with most other commodities or assets. Bitcoin is different.
